DocuSign
Empowering Global Trust
DocuSign is trusted by 250,000 companies and over 100 million users in 188 countries to sign anything, anywhere, anytime, on any device, securely. Companies of every size and industry trust DocuSign to help them keep business fully digital to achieve dramatic ROI, increased security and compliance, and better customer experience.
Challenge
DocuSign’s digital signature service required extraordinarily heavy and unique compliance standards as well as strong security. Supporting their position as the global leader in eSignatures, DocuSign required secure datacenters in multiple markets around the world. The infrastructure teams needed to focus on solving engineering challenges, not executing vendor due diligence.
Approach
Avail aligned strategy and culture provided by the CTO with the technical requirements of the operations teams. The DocuSign Infrastructure team provided datacenter specifications, audit requirements, and target markets. While keeping DocuSign anonymous, Avail independently produced Market Intelligence Assessments for each market, identifying the vendors best suited to the requirements.
Services
Solutions Design and Validation
Market Intelligence Assessment (domestic and international)
Proposal Management
Results
DocuSign can more effectively drive their business forward with the confidence of Avail’s independent due diligence. Avail’s daily research and targeted due diligence on hundreds of vendors domestically and abroad empowers DocuSign to continue it’s dominance as a global eSignature service. Avail’s continued efforts with DocuSign achieves:
Independent pricing validation (domestic and international)
Rapid due diligence for operations teams
Complete Confidentiality through client anonymity